DEPARTMENT: Senior Services
PROGRAM: BEST/NORC - 72 Columbia St., New York, NY 10002
REPORTS TO: Program Director
LOCATION: New York, NY (Lower East Side)
SALARY: $23 per hour; 21 hours per week
SCHEDULE: Monday–Friday, 8:30am – 4:30pm. Weekends as needed.
DATE: October 2025
JOB SUMMARY: Supports Case Assistance and Case Management of the BEST program by coordinating activities and tasks that ensures efficient and effective delivery of services to the program participants. The case worker will provide the following services to meet program participant’s health and psychosocial needs, with a focus on homebound seniors at risk of social isolation: (1) intake assessment and updates, (2) case planning and coordination, (3) evaluation, (4) advocacy for services to participants
Education, Experience And Skill Requirement
- BA in social work, psychology, or a related field preferred or Associate Degree in Human Services
- Excellent communication, analytical and problem-solving skills
- Bilingual English/Spanish
- Experience in the delivery of social services to seniors
- Strong computer skills: Excel, Word & Data Entry
- Provides case assistance and case management to participants, documents intervention in client files, tracks services in worker logs and enter data into funder database (DFTA PeerPlace)
- Identify and provide Norc Assessment to homebound seniors residing in the Baruch Housing, with a focus on those who are at risk of social isolation.
- Conduct initial interview and complete intake assessment that identifies participant’s needs. In collaboration with the client, formulate goals and objectives, as well as appropriate time-line for completion.
- Assist participants in obtaining services and entitlements including Medicaid, food stamps, SCRIE, home care referrals, and others.
- Complete enrollment of all NDA clients which includes assessment, follow up notes, and conducting outcome. Enter data into funder database (DYCD Connect). It will be provided at all three sites for enrollment of NDA clients.
- Assist providing GMHI screening to support increasing Baruch community’s mental health awareness.
- Assists with coordination of program events as needed
- Conducted home visits with our home bound participants as needed
- Provided translation services for clients for our nurse services and counseling services
- Assists in the Food Distributions/Food Pantry as needed
- Connect seniors to GSS Senior Center/NORC/Essex Crossing activities
- Other special projects or miscellaneous program duties as needed
